Transaction 6aa81e71b4def0f2ef930b11ccde6bfd97df76897eef1e7650e6fc0b9017fb86

1 Input
2 Outputs
  • 6aa81e71b4def0f2ef930b11ccde6bfd97df76897eef1e7650e6fc0b9017fb86:0
  • value  503636
    address  174xK811fDZAtni8ZRFQsKGqyKPK6bP8tV
  • 6aa81e71b4def0f2ef930b11ccde6bfd97df76897eef1e7650e6fc0b9017fb86:1
  • value  23995008
    address  17UHLuhLoh87DJ91EmBHa4Wh5mcDRTJaWH